From my experience, Santito's always been worth seeing live. I've seen him a handful of times and his usual offense of the Santo headscissors, his tope de Christo combo, armdrags and hurricaranas are always a blast to experience in person. I think he's the smoothest worker I've ever seen live.

We ended up going to NJ which at least made this seem a little more adventurous. Unfortunately it was the same card (we had an opener with what appeared to be two locals as well). I had fun but this thing really dragged on. The amount of time between matches was ridiculous. I'm not enough of a grouch to complain about kids posing with the wrestlers between matches but there were a few instances where the pauses continued after that was over. It was like a wrestling show with multiple intermissions.

Santo looked pretty good even though the main event made hardly any sense. They put so much heat on Oliver John that when he was eliminated the crowd stopped caring. Porky always amuses me. Disappointed about Cassandro. Oh well.
